Yupia, May 7 (NationPress) The Treasurer of the All India Football Federation and Honourary Secretary of the Arunachal Pradesh Football Association, Mr. Kipa Ajay, warmly welcomed the delegates from the South Asian Football Federation to the city in anticipation of the upcoming SAFF U19 Championship.

This championship, commencing on May 9, will feature six teams from South Asia competing for the title of sub-continental champions in the U19 category, with the final set for May 18.

India is placed in Group B, kicking off their journey against Sri Lanka on Friday, May 9, at the Golden Jubilee Stadium. Nepal is also in their group, with their match on May 13. Group A consists of Bangladesh, Bhutan, and Maldives.

Mr. Kipa Ajay stated, “I am delighted to welcome the SAFF delegates to Arunachal Pradesh and express my gratitude for hosting the SAFF U19 Championship in our state. We aspire to conduct this tournament in a magnificent and successful way that instills pride in everyone involved.”

He added, “With the support of our Chief Minister, Shri Pema Khandu ji, who is very passionate about football, we have prepared thoroughly to meet the demands of this international tournament. We learned valuable lessons from our experience hosting the Santosh Trophy in 2024 and will apply those insights to overcome previous challenges.”

SAFF General Secretary, Shri Purushottam Kattel, praised the efforts of the APFA and expressed hopes for a “special” tournament.

“I spoke with the APFA Secretary, who conveyed his ambition to make this the best SAFF U19 Championship ever. From what I’ve observed so far, all necessary preparations are already in place,” he remarked. “This is a beneficial situation for everyone involved, and I hope it transforms into a memorable tournament for all, with the best team prevailing.”
